Export and data shape

  • Which Payroll Software records, attachments, comments, custom fields, automations, permissions, and audit trails can be exported before cancellation?
  • Can the buyer test an export from Gusto Simple Payroll, OnPay Payroll, Patriot Full Service Payroll, QuickBooks Online Payroll Core or the current vendor before committing to the new workflow?
  • Which reports, IDs, approval states, historical activity, or files will be lost, flattened, or recreated manually?

Implementation and rollback

  • What has to run in parallel until the new platform is proven?
  • Which integrations, webhooks, accounting syncs, directories, or support channels break if object IDs or workflow states change?
  • Who owns rollback if the new tool fails during the first live cycle?

Contract and renewal timing

  • What notice period, auto-renewal clause, downgrade rule, data retention period, or support cutoff affects the switch date?
  • Which implementation, onboarding, migration, support, storage, API, or overage fees are outside the quoted price?
  • What written evidence should be collected before approving the switch?

Operational ownership

  • Which internal owner signs off on roles, permissions, data cleanup, training, and final cutover?
  • Which users or teams will lose a familiar workflow and need a written fallback?
  • What public-safe information can be shared for a fixed-scope risk review without exposing contracts, credentials, logs, or customer data?

Public Product Context

CandidateBest useAvoid ifTypical price
Gusto Simple PayrollUS small businesses that need full-service payroll tax filing and basic supportyou only pay contractors occasionally and want the lowest possible monthly base$948
OnPay Payrollsmall businesses comparing transparent payroll pricing and guided setupyou need a global employer-of-record platform or deep enterprise HR suite$948
Patriot Full Service Payrollbudget-focused small businesses that want payroll tax filing at a lower base priceyou need advanced HR benefits administration or enterprise payroll support$744
QuickBooks Online Payroll CoreQuickBooks users who want accounting and payroll in one workflowyou do not use QuickBooks accounting and want a standalone payroll-first stack$678
